Dangerous operation at Townsville

Two people have been arrested following the alleged dangerous operation of a bus in Townsville last night.

Around 8pm, police received reports of a bus was driving erratically on the Bruce Highway at Alligator Creek.

Police intercept the bus at a shopping centre on MacArthur Drive, Annandale using stingers. When the bus came to a stop, it damaged a police car and two officers were injured.

It will be alleged the bus had been stolen from Woodstock-Giru Road south of Townsville.

A man and woman were arrested at the scene and are assisting police with their investigation.
